No One Lives Forever final demo

Monolith releases a new demo for its acclaimed first-person shooter that includes additional free levels.

Comments

Although a smaller demo has been available for some time, Monolith has released a new expanded demo of No One Lives Forever. The new version is dubbed the Mega Mix demo, and it includes four single-player levels and two multiplayer maps. No One Lives Forever is a first-person shooter in which you play as superspy Cate Archer, who must stop an international conspiracy. The game's story has the offbeat style of 1960s spy movies and the dialog is irreverently funny, yet the game still packs in a wide variety of weapons and spy gadgets to make for exhilarating gameplay. No One Lives Forever was chosen as GameSpot's Best Action Game of 2000. If you haven't had the chance to try it out and can download the 129MB file, grab it from the link below.
